Letter to be circulated to parents and carers by Hertfordshire County Council.
Inspection of Hertfordshire County Council local area’s effectiveness in identifying and meeting the needs of, generic cialis and improving outcomes for, children and young people who have special educational needs and/or disabilities from 4 July 2016 to 8 July 2016
Ofsted and the Care Quality Commission (CQC) will carry out jointly an inspection of your local area.

The inspection will evaluate how effectively the local area:

  • identifies the needs of children and young people who have special educational needs and/or disabilities
  •  meets the needs of these children and young people so that their outcomes and chances of participating fully in society improve.

The views of children and young people who have special educational needs and/or disabilities, and the views of their parents and carers will be gathered during visits to a number of early years settings, schools, colleges and specialist services. These views are critical to the inspection process. During the inspection, Ofsted and CQC inspectors will be keen to speak to as many children and young people and their parents and carers as possible. Inspectors will select a range of settings to visit and will work with the local authority and its partners to inform children and young people who attend those settings, and their parents and carers, in advance so that they are able to contribute their views. The inspection will also include an online webinar to allow other Hertfordshire County Council parents and carer to contribute.

The webinar will take place at 6.30pm on Wednesday 6 July 2016. It will led by Heather Yaxley, Her Majesty’s Inspector, will ask parents and carers about their views and experiences on how effectively Hertfordshire County Council is fulfilling the above responsibilities.
While we understand that many parents and carers may have views on their experience that extend before the implementation of the reforms in September 2014, it is important that this date is used as the start for gathering evidence about the impact of the reforms as part of our new inspections. We would also like parents and carers to understand that we will not be able to follow up or comment upon individual cases.
